Gear VR fishing game Bait! catches 150,000 downloads in first five days of release

First download data released for an Oculus-powered game

Gear VR fishing game Bait! catches 150,000 downloads in first five days of release

Stockholm-based VR developer Resolution Games has revealed download data from the first five days of release of its fishing game, Bait!.

The game, released on the Gear VR, has been downloaded almost 150,000 times, with users across 160 different countries around the world.

Plenty of fish in the sea

“It is amazing to see how widespread and global the interest is and with so many fish already caught it’s apparent the game is luring in players for longer play sessions,” said Tommy Palm, CEO and co-founder of Resolution Games.

“We couldn't be happier with the excitement from users around Bait! We’re hearing from players of all kinds about their experiences with the game – whether new to VR and fishing or old hats to both.”

This is reportedly the first time download data has been shared about an Oculus-powered game, offering a small glimpse into the actual install base of the Gear VR.
